About Trix cereal

Trix Cereal is a popular breakfast option originally introduced in the United States in 1954 by General Mills. This cereal is made with whole grain corn and sweetened with sugar, featuring vibrant, fruit-shaped pieces with artificial and natural flavors. While Trix is fortified with essential vitamins and minerals like calcium and iron, a single serving also contains added sugars, which may contribute to excessive calorie intake if not paired with a balanced diet. It is free of high fructose corn syrup but includes artificial colors, which some individuals may wish to avoid. Trix is considered a processed food and lacks significant fiber or protein content, making it a less optimal choice for sustained energy and satiety compared to whole-grain, less sweetened cereals. Enjoyed primarily for its playful flavors and fun appeal, it represents a nostalgic and indulgent breakfast or snack within American cuisine.
